Well... I had the drone fixed for a few days. Thought I would visit one of my favorites stops on my weekly State College, PA-to-Stamford, CT drive. This is at Turtle Beach, part of the Delaware Water Gap recreational area. You can get down close to the water and I thought this would be a nice place for good fall foliage reflections.

So everything is going well and I'm getting some nice video and I see the graffiti on the far left and thought maybe I'll fly over that direction. Still trying to keep my straight on shot. At that point of the beach however, it was all water and mud, so I stayed where I was and that's the beauty of the drone, it can go where you can't.

Well... because of either the sun, or my bad eyes, I lost sight of the drone, which wasn't that far away from me. But it must have hit a tree limb that was sticking farther out than the trees, and down it went into the water.

So... long story short, some extremely muddy pants, shoes and socks, and at one point I thought I was going to be full-on submersed into the creek... I retrieved the drone. Lost a propeller set, but it was still on, lights flashing and battery running. Got home, got the card out, battery off, let it dry out as much as possible. It still turns on now... and connects to the RC and the phone, but it won't calibrate... I may have run out of lives for this drone.

Anyway, enjoy the reflection! The original image and the edited image are from a still, not from the video. I haven't been able to look at any of the stats from the flight yet. Camera settings: JPEG, 1/40 sec at f/2.6, ISO 200
